News summary

As the A-League celebrates its 20th season, former player Harrison Sawyer is making a notable return with Macarthur FC after a seven-year absence, expressing excitement about his growth and experience gained abroad (source 1). Meanwhile, a controversial World Cup qualifier between Indonesia and Bahrain led to widespread outrage over a referee's decision to extend stoppage time, prompting Indonesia's football association to lodge a formal protest to FIFA and the AFC (source 2). In rugby, the Pacific Rugby League Bowl Championship is set to strengthen ties among Pacific Island nations, with Fiji Bati facing PNG Kumuls in a highly anticipated match (source 3). Additionally, a historic rugby league matchup between indigenous teams from Wellington and Australia highlighted cultural exchange and unity after 50 years (source 4). Lastly, Australia's football struggles against Japan continue as they prepare for a crucial World Cup qualifier, with Japan now holding a significant advantage in their recent encounters (source 5).
